Reasons behind Usage of Online Dating Apps

Online dating apps have experienced a surge in popularity in recent years due to the ease of use and convenience they offer. According to a survey conducted by Statista in 2020, 80% of online daters said they chose to use online dating apps because they are convenient and more accessible than traditional dating. Moreover, they can allow people to find someone who is compatible with their lifestyle and preferences without the need to invest time and energy into searching offline. Online dating apps can also provide users with a safe and private environment for testing the waters before deciding if they want to pursue a relationship further. It is estimated that dating app usage has increased to 58% compared to 44% over the last ten years as more people feel comfortable exploring their options through application-based conversations.

Fees and Privacy

Free online dating apps usually make their money through ads, in-app purchases, and subscriptions. It is important to note, however, that while some apps may offer a low entry price point, they may have additional fees associated with them. In addition, some apps may require users to link their social media accounts or provide other sensitive information before their profile is visible. It is important to research an app before deciding to use it to ensure the safety and security of personal data. When it comes to privacy, free online dating apps may be slightly less secure than their paid counterparts. Many free dating sites are not subject to the same regulatory oversight as paid ones which means that users may not have the same safety protocols available when searching for a match or communicating with potential dates.

The Pros and Cons of Free Online Dating Apps

One of the major pros of using free online dating apps is their convenience. Online dating apps allow users to access a variety of people at any time and from any location. This makes it easier to find someone who is compatible with their lifestyle and preferences. Another pro is that the activity is often anonymous meaning there is no way to be identified or tracked by strangers. Despite the convenience of online dating apps, there are a few drawbacks. For example, some users may be subjected to harassment or abuse by other users which could lead to safety concerns. Additionally, some users may find it more difficult to get to know a potential match given the limited amount of information available.

Tips for Successful Online Dating

Whether you are using a free online dating app or a paid one, there are several tips to help make sure you have a successful online dating experience. First, be honest and clear about what you are looking for in a partner and make sure your profile accurately reflects that. Secondly, try to be open-minded when dating online, considering different perspectives and expectations can make conversations more interesting. Additionally, it is important to be aware of safety protocols and always meet in public for the first couple of dates. Finally, be patient and enjoy the process, as it can be very rewarding.

Online Dating Etiquette

It is important to be aware of the dos and don'ts when it comes to online dating etiquette. For example, it is considered good manners to respond promptly to messages, and be respectful and courteous when talking to potential matches. Additionally, it is important to show interest without being overly pushy and to be conscious of the other person’s feelings and communication needs. On the other hand, it is important to practice self-care when using online dating apps. Just because someone is online does not necessarily mean they are interested in pursuing a relationship. Therefore, it is okay to take a break if needed, and to move on if it doesn’t feel like the right fit.

Creating an Effective Profile

When creating a profile for online dating apps, it is helpful to keep some tips in mind. Using a clear and recent photo, accurately depicting yourself and conveying your unique personality can be the first step. It is also important to be honest and clear about what you are looking for, and use specific terms to describe this. Additionally, try to keep the profile balanced and honest by focusing on positives and negatives equally. Writing your profile in the first person (I/me/my) can also be a great way to create a more personal connection with potential matches.
